jokingly

英 [ˈdʒəʊkɪŋli]

美 [ˈdʒoʊkɪŋli]

adv.  开玩笑地; 闹着玩地; 戏谑地

BNC.20716 / COCA.14605

牛津词典

    adv.

    • 开玩笑地;闹着玩地;戏谑地
      in a way that is intended to be amusing and not serious

      柯林斯词典

      • ADV 开玩笑地;闹着玩地;戏谑地
        If you say or do somethingjokingly, you say or do it with the intention of amusing someone, rather than with any serious meaning or intention.
        1. Sarah jokingly called her 'my monster'...
          萨拉戏称她为“我的怪兽”。
        2. She frowned at him, only half-jokingly.
          她半开玩笑地冲他皱了皱眉。

      英英释义

      adv

      • not seriously
        1. I meant it facetiously
        Synonym:facetiouslytongue-in-cheek
      • in jest
        1. I asked him jokingly whether he thought he could drive the Calcutta-Peshawar express
        Synonym:jestingly
